Abstract
The propulsion system includes an internal combustion engine, an electric machine and a double-clutch transmission with a clutch unit and a mechanical gearbox. The gearbox has two coaxial primary shafts intended to be torsionally connected each to a shaft of the internal combustion engine of the motor vehicle by a respective friction clutch of the clutch unit, as well as a secondary shaft and a lay shaft arranged parallel to the two primary shafts. The electric machine is permanently kinematically connected to either of the two primary shafts via a first gear train including a pinion mounted on an output shaft of the electric machine, an intermediate gearwheel mounted on an intermediate shaft and a gearwheel mounted on the primary shaft and acting as driving gearwheel of a second gear train of the gearbox associated to one of the gears, in particular to the second forward gear. The gearbox further includes a casing and the electric machine is inserted and fixed into a seat formed by that casing.
